Output dd7f3a1959122e57832f82424f93f4c2ffeab5a4c8a72b1c3542c0bdbd8c076a:0

value
550680
script pubkey
OP_0 OP_PUSHBYTES_20 781cc672d675f72672b65d6f5e5eb3a975bc77aa
address
bc1q0qwvvukkwhmjvu4kt4h4uh4n496mcaa2trtld8
transaction
dd7f3a1959122e57832f82424f93f4c2ffeab5a4c8a72b1c3542c0bdbd8c076a
confirmations
49800
spent
true